War of the Worlds (2017) is an upcoming professional wrestling tour co-produced by the American Ring of Honor (ROH), WWE and Japanese New Japan Pro Wrestling (NJPW) promotions. The tour's four events are scheduled to take place on May 7, 10, 12 and 14 at various venues throughout the United Kingdom. The third night will air live on pay-per-view (PPV), while fourth night will be taped for future episodes of ROH's weekly television program, Ring of Honor Wrestling. 2017 will be the fourth year in which ROH and NJPW co-produce events under the War of the Worlds name.
